How Much Is Jaden Ivey Worth On An Extension With The Detroit Pistons? | Marcus Sasser Hidden Gem?
Jaden Ivey’s contract extension looms large for the Detroit Pistons. Is the young guard worth $22-24 million per year?
Host Ku Khahil breaks down Ivey’s potential value, comparing him to similar players and analyzing insights from John Hollinger of The Athletic. The discussion shifts to Marcus Sasser’s hidden potential, with a deep dive into his impressive efficiency statistics and a comparison to Payton Pritchard. Ku also examines the recent signing of Javonte Green and its implications for the Pistons’ roster composition.
